Just a short walk from the Puget Sound, you'll find Rowandale. A mid-century modern charmer, this home gets its name from the beautiful Rowan Tree nestled in front of the home. A place of pure peace and warm welcomes, the home has been adorned with touches of Pacific Northwest, Scandinavian, and Japanese influence.
Walking inside, you will instantly take notice of the light-filled living room. Composed of high ceilings, comfortable furnishings, and floor-to-ceiling windows, this room offers a serene spot to sit back, visit, and stream your favorite shows. Steps away, the updated kitchen radiantly gleams with its white tile backsplash and stainless steel appliances. When mealtime rolls around, dine family-style at the formal dining table, or take your culinary creations outside where you can dine al fresco on the deck.
Through exploring the rest of the home, you will find a cozy media room, complete with another large TV, a work desk, and a bookshelf full of travel books. Everyone's slumber is guaranteed to be restful amongst the bedroom's soft linens, inviting color palettes, and central air-conditioning.
Away from Rowandale, visit Chambers Bay PGA Golf Course (1.6 miles), Fort Steilacoom Park (5.4 miles), the Museum of Glass (8.6 miles), and the Washington State Fair Events Center (18.4 miles).

Damage waiver: The total cost of your reservation for this Property includes a nightly damage waiver fee, plus tax if applicable (the “Damage Waiver”). (A discount may be applied for stays of 28 nights or longer, if permitted.) The Damage Waiver covers you for up to $3,000 of accidental damage to the Property or its contents (such as furniture, fixtures, and appliances) as long as you report the incident to the host prior to checking out. The Damage Waiver fee eliminates the need for a traditional security deposit. More information can be downloaded from the "Rental Agreement" on the checkout page.
